What is an at home RN?

At Home RNs, also known as home health registered nurses, are licensed nurses who provide medical care to patients in their own homes. They typically assist patients recovering from illness, surgery, or injury, and may also care for those with chronic health conditions. Their responsibilities include administering medications, monitoring vital signs, educating patients and their families, and coordinating with other healthcare professionals. At Home RNs help ensure patients receive quality care outside of a traditional hospital or clinic setting, promoting recovery and independence.

What are some common challenges faced by an at home RN, and how can they effectively manage them?

At Home Registered Nurses (RNs) often encounter challenges such as working independently without immediate access to colleagues, managing diverse patient needs in non-clinical environments, and adapting to varying home conditions. To effectively manage these challenges, At Home RNs should maintain strong communication with their healthcare team, utilize telehealth tools for support, and stay organized with thorough documentation. Building rapport with patients and their families is also crucial to ensure smooth care delivery and address any concerns promptly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an at home RN, and why are they important?

To thrive as an At Home RN, you need strong clinical assessment skills, nursing credentials (such as an active RN license), and experience in home health care. Familiarity with telehealth platforms, remote patient monitoring systems, and electronic health records is typically required. Exceptional communication, independence, and time management are vital soft skills for working autonomously and supporting patients in their own environments. These competencies ensure safe, effective care delivery and foster trust while adapting to the unique challenges of home-based nursing.

What kind of nursing can I do from home?

At-home RNs can perform telehealth nursing, providing patient assessments, education, and care management remotely using phone or video communication. They often handle chronic disease management, medication monitoring, and health coaching, requiring relevant licensure and strong communication skills.

Job description

Home Visits in Long Beach, LA, Paramount, Lynwood, Bell Flower, Walnut area.  Must have at least 1 year experience in home health setting.

RN-Home Health Nurse, or Home Health RN, is responsible for traveling to a patient’s home to assess and administer their services and helping patients maintain their independence. Their duties include administering at-home IVs, changing dressings, cleaning wounds and updating Doctors about their patient’s health.

LVN- Home visits duties for an LVN include collecting vital information from patients, gathering information about health complaints, changing wound dressings, removing stitches, explaining prescriptions and assisting patients.
